Explaining IronNet


IronNet is a defense company started by former General Keith Alexander, who was previously the Director of the National Security Agency (NSA) and Commander of US Cyber Command. The company's goal is to help companies that face complex cyber dangers find and deal with advanced risks.


IronNet's method to hacking is to use big data analytics and machine learning techniques to find unusual behavior on networks in real time. This makes it easier to find threats and respond to them quickly, which can be very important in avoiding major damage from computer attacks.


In addition to its cutting-edge technology, IronNet also has a team of highly experienced cybersecurity experts who have worked in government spy agencies, the military, and private business. Their knowledge helps make sure that customers get top-notch services that are suited to their wants.

How IronNet Navy Contract is Helping to Protect the Navy's Networks


The goal of IronNet's relationship with the US Navy is to improve protection steps for vital activities and private information. The advanced danger identification technology made by IronNet is working to protect the Navy's networks from both internal and foreign cyberattacks.


IronDefense, IronNet's main offering, gives real-time danger information by studying network traffic trends from many different sources. This helps find possible threats that standard security systems might miss, allowing quick responses to stop or lessen attacks.


The answer also makes it easier to see what users are doing in the Navy's network system. By watching and studying how users act, IronDefense can spot strange behavior that could mean an account or device has been hacked. This makes sure that the right steps can be taken before any damage happens.


Also, IronNet uses machine learning techniques to improve its ability to find things over time. These systems constantly learn from new data feeds and get better at spotting threats. This means that as more data goes through the system, it becomes even better at spotting oddities and stopping attacks.
